Solution for 3542 is what percent of 73:

3542:73*100 =

(3542*100):73 =

354200:73 = 4852.05

Now we have: 3542 is what percent of 73 = 4852.05

Question: 3542 is what percent of 73?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 73 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={73}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={3542}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={73}(1).

{x\%}={3542}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{73}{3542}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{3542}{73}

\Rightarrow{x} = {4852.05\%}

Therefore, {3542} is {4852.05\%} of {73}.
